Mr. P. B. Patil, learned Counsel filed vakilpatra on behalf of respondent No. 2-original complainant/injured. Same is taken on record.
-22.
The applicants and respondent No. 2 are personally present in the Court, who are identified by their respective Counsel. The parties have placed on record compromise deed, same is taken on record and marked 'X' for identification.
3.
The applicants and complainant are relatives and therefore they have decided to settle the matter. They further stated that the agreement / compromise is not executed under duress or compulsion or out of pressure. The compromise/agreement appears to be voluntarily. In addition to that, an additional affidavit on behalf of the respondent No.2 - original complainant has also been filed before this Court.
4.
In view thereof, Criminal Revision Application is allowed. The offence is compounded. The judgment and order passed by the learned Adhoc District Judge-3 & Additional Sessions Judge, Ahmednagar in Criminal Appeal No. 18 of 2009 on 17/03/2015 and conviction awarded by learned Judicial Magistrate, Ahmednagar in Regular Trial Case No. 281 of 2006 on 09/01/2009 is quashed and set aside. The applicants are acquitted for the offence punishable under Section 324 read with Section 34 of the Indian Penal Code.
